Output 58ec28ea89c6ad0757c974d21e1e34dc645adc7441e80f8a84d225c9e3a02bca:0

value
37455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d90ba45ff12095c28b6c6b381057ccbbafb37a OP_EQUAL
address
3Le1oqV8u14cV6DYJVQGPmCoSxui3sPWgV
transaction
58ec28ea89c6ad0757c974d21e1e34dc645adc7441e80f8a84d225c9e3a02bca
spent
true